Where is Hampton Inn Albany-Wolf Road located?
Hampton Inn Albany-Wolf Road, Hampton Inn Albany-Wolf Road, United States of America (approx. 42.7247°, -73.79576°)
Hampton Inn Albany-Wolf Road, Hampton Inn Albany-Wolf Road, United States of America (approx. 42.7247°, -73.79576°)